"Hitler treated the murder of the Jews as a matter of the utmost secrecy and was careful wherever possible not to leave behind any written orders.The aim of the book is to offer documentary proof of Hitler's central role in the murder of European Jews.Various documents and fragments of documents have been pieced together and the codified language of the dictator deciphered."
